While Annex V serves an essential function, there are some controversies regarding its application. One concern is the potential for overlooking risks associated with exempt substances, particularly if new scientific data emerges about their toxicological profiles. Additionally, the criteria for exemption may not always keep pace with evolving scientific understanding, leading to debates over whether certain substances should remain exempt. As such, ongoing review and potential revisions to Annex V may be necessary to ensure continued protection of human health and the environment.
